St. Augustine thatch removal can help a struggling lawn, but aggressive treatment can damage the grass you're trying to save. In Southwest Florida, the safest plan starts with measuring the thatch layer, checking the lawn's health, and choosing a time when the grass is actively growing.

A thin layer usually needs better mowing, watering, and soil care rather than mechanical dethatching. Before you reach for a power machine, identify what's actually affecting your lawn and match the treatment to the problem.

What thatch looks like in St. Augustine grass

Thatch is a tightly woven layer of undecomposed stolons, roots, crowns, and other organic material between the green canopy and the soil. St. Augustinegrass produces above-ground runners, so some organic buildup is normal.

The problem begins when the layer becomes thick enough to block water, fertilizer, and air from reaching the root zone. UF/IFAS uses 1 inch as the point where vertical mowing or more serious thatch removal may be considered.

Measure before removing anything

Use a hand trowel to cut a small square of turf in several parts of the yard. Choose areas that look healthy, thin, brown, or unusually spongy. Lift the section carefully, then measure the compressed brown layer between the leaf canopy and the soil.

Measure the fibrous mat only. Don't count loose leaves sitting on top, green blades, or normal stolons lying across the soil surface. A thatch layer under 1 inch usually doesn't justify aggressive mechanical work.

Roots growing above the soil and into the thatch are another warning sign. These roots dry out quickly and leave the turf more vulnerable during hot, dry weather.

Don't confuse thatch with other lawn problems

Dead leaves and loose grass blades often disappear after firm hand raking. Grass clippings don't cause thatch because they break down quickly in healthy soil.

Compacted soil creates a different set of symptoms. Water may puddle, a screwdriver may struggle to enter the ground, and roots may remain shallow even when the surface looks green. Core aeration addresses compaction, while dethatching removes organic buildup.

Chinch bugs can also hide in thatch and cause yellow or brown patches. To check a damaged edge, sink a coffee can with both ends removed about 3 inches into the turf. Fill it with water and watch for five minutes. Chinch bugs should float to the surface.

Fungal disease can create similar patches, especially after wet weather or excess fertilization. Expanding areas, damaged leaf sheaths, or repeated decline after irrigation changes deserve a closer diagnosis before you disturb the lawn.

St. Augustine thatch removal: decide if your lawn is ready

A thick thatch layer doesn't automatically mean the lawn should be dethatched today. St. Augustinegrass needs enough energy to repair damaged stolons and roots after vertical mowing.

If the thatch is less than 1 inch thick, correcting water, mowing, and fertilizer practices is often safer than removing it mechanically.

Check the lawn's condition first

Healthy, actively spreading grass has the best chance of recovering. Look for firm green runners, new leaf growth, and consistent color across most of the yard. The soil shouldn't be bone-dry, saturated, or muddy.

Delay treatment when the lawn is under drought stress, recovering from installation, heavily damaged by insects, or showing an active disease pattern. Mechanical dethatching creates wounds in the turf. Stressed grass may take longer to close those openings.

Also check your irrigation coverage. A dry zone caused by a clogged nozzle won't improve after thatch removal. In some cases, the irrigation problem is the main reason the lawn looks thin.

Choose the active-growth season

UF/IFAS recommends vertical mowing while St. Augustinegrass is actively growing. In South Florida, that generally means a window between about March and August, although weather and lawn condition matter more than a calendar date.

Early summer can work well when the lawn has regular moisture and strong growth. Avoid treating dormant or slow-growing turf during cooler periods. A late-season job may leave bare areas exposed before the grass can recover.

Rainy-season weather doesn't automatically make every day suitable. Saturated soil can compact under equipment, while repeated heavy rain can worsen fungal problems. Choose a dry day when the soil is moist but firm and the lawn is growing steadily.

The safest way to remove excessive thatch

When the layer measures more than 1 inch and the grass is healthy, use the least aggressive method that can solve the problem. St. Augustinegrass can be injured by aggressive mechanical dethatching because its stolons sit close to the surface.

  1. Start by mowing at the lawn's normal height. Never lower the mower to shave away the thatch, and remove no more than one-third of the leaf blade.
  2. Use a stiff hand rake for light buildup or small problem areas. Pull gently enough to remove loose material without tearing healthy runners from the soil.
  3. Leave heavy buildup to a professional with a properly adjusted vertical mower. UF/IFAS lists about 3-inch blade spacing for St. Augustinegrass, but the depth still needs adjustment for the turf and soil.
  4. Make a controlled pass instead of repeatedly grinding over the same area. The blades should reach the thatch layer without cutting deeply into the crown, stolons, or soil.
  5. Rake, sweep, or vacuum the loosened material as soon as the work ends. Leaving a thick layer of dry debris on the lawn can block light and hold excess moisture against the leaves.

A rental machine set too low can scalp the lawn in minutes. It may also tear runners into short pieces and expose roots to Southwest Florida's heat. If you can't see the thatch clearly or don't know how to adjust the equipment, hand rake a small test area or stop and get an assessment.

Care for the lawn after thatch removal

Dethatching is a recovery event, not routine weekly maintenance. The lawn needs careful moisture and moderate mowing while new growth fills the disturbed areas.

Water the exposed root zone

UF/IFAS guidance recommends about 3/4 inch of water immediately after vertical mowing to help prevent exposed roots from drying. Apply that amount only if rainfall hasn't already supplied it. A rain gauge or shallow container can help you check the output.

After the first irrigation, return to an as-needed schedule. Established St. Augustinegrass needs water when the leaves fold, wilt, turn blue-gray, or leave footprints that remain visible after walking across the lawn.

Water deeply enough to wet the root zone, then allow the surface to dry before watering again. Short daily cycles can keep the canopy wet and encourage shallow roots. Inspect each irrigation zone because a broken head or poor spray pattern can leave part of the lawn dry.

Keep mowing high and delay fertilizer

Standard St. Augustine cultivars such as Floratam, BitterBlue, and Classic generally perform best at 3.5 to 4 inches . Dwarf cultivars need a shorter setting, often around 2 to 2.5 inches. Check the variety before adjusting the mower.

Wait about one week after vertical mowing before fertilizing. UF/IFAS guidance uses a maximum of 1 pound of actual nitrogen per 1,000 square feet per application . That is the amount of nitrogen, not the total weight of the fertilizer bag.

Choose a slow-release nitrogen product and water it in immediately. Heavy applications of quick-release nitrogen can push soft growth and increase chinch-bug pressure. A recovering lawn needs steady nutrition, not a large dose.

Clean up and monitor the recovery

Remove loosened thatch from the lawn, beds, drains, and hard surfaces. Dry material left against sidewalks can wash into storm drains, while piles near the turf can hold moisture and attract pests.

Watch the lawn for two to four weeks. New runners, fresh green blades, and less sponginess indicate recovery. Avoid unnecessary herbicides or insecticides while the grass is stressed. Treat pests or disease only after confirming the problem and following the product label.

Prevent another heavy thatch layer

Good lawn care reduces the conditions that cause thatch to accumulate. In Southwest Florida landscaping, the most common contributors are excess nitrogen, frequent watering, poor soil drainage, and compacted soil.

Adjust watering, mowing, and fertilizer

Overwatering keeps the soil and thatch layer wet, which slows decomposition. It can also promote shallow roots and fungal problems. Water when the lawn shows stress, then apply enough to wet the root zone instead of running short cycles every day.

Keep standard St. Augustine at its recommended height. Cutting too low removes too much leaf tissue, weakens the runners, and leaves the crowns exposed. Sharpen mower blades so the grass receives a clean cut rather than a torn edge.

Use fertilizer according to a soil test, turf variety, and local application rules. Minimal nitrogen is usually better than repeated high-nitrogen treatments. Leave normal clippings on the lawn because they decompose readily and don't create the dense organic mat associated with thatch.

Aerate compacted soil instead of dethatching it

If water runs off, puddles, or takes a long time to soak in, the lawn may need core aeration. Aeration removes small soil plugs and opens channels for water, air, and roots. It doesn't remove a thick thatch layer, so test the soil and thatch separately.

A light topdressing can also support decomposition. UF/IFAS guidance describes applying roughly 1/4 inch of soil similar to the existing soil, or using sand where appropriate. Avoid burying the canopy or applying a heavy layer. Excess topdressing can increase disease risk, including large patch problems.

When professional help makes sense

Professional help is warranted when the thatch exceeds 1 inch across much of the yard, the grass lifts easily, roots sit above the soil, or mechanical treatment could expose large bare areas. A qualified crew can measure several locations, identify the turf variety, adjust the equipment, and avoid cutting into the crowns.

Call for an inspection when brown patches continue expanding, the coffee-can test suggests chinch bugs, irrigation coverage is uneven, or the lawn shows signs of fungal disease. The correct solution might be pest treatment, irrigation repair, core aeration, drainage work, or selective sod replacement instead of dethatching.

Conclusion

A brown, spongy St. Augustine lawn needs diagnosis before it needs a machine. Measure the layer, separate thatch from compaction, dead leaves, chinch bugs, and disease, then treat only when the grass is actively growing.

The safest St. Augustine thatch removal uses the least aggressive effective method, avoids scalping, and follows with proper cleanup, irrigation, high mowing, and delayed fertilization. When the layer is thick or the cause is uncertain, an accurate inspection can protect the lawn from damage that a rushed cleanup would create.
